Get startedBakery Cottage is an end-of-terrace house in Ottery St Mary (EX11 1EY).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 616 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(December 2008)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 75). The latest certificate is from December 2008,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 22 years, with the last transfer in December 2003. Today's modelled estimate of £192,000 sits 88.2% above the 2003 sale of £102,000. At 57 m² it's 15.3%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(68 m² median across 10 EPCs).
